Sanders Gets Two Streets

Level 8 : 500/1,000, 100 ante

Michael Sanders bet 3,000 against two opponents on a board of {3-Clubs}{a-Clubs}{a-Diamonds}{9-Diamonds}, and the player on the button called before a player who checked from the blinds mucked. Sanders bet 4,000 on the {3-Spades} river and his opponent quickly called. Sanders showed {j-Diamonds}{j-Spades} and his opponent mucked {7-Hearts}{7-Clubs} face-up.

Elsewhere in the tournament, Mary Ellen Roy's early good fortune proved to be fool's gold as she just busted out and reentered. Troy Repp is up to about 100,000.

Torres Piling Chips

Level 8 : 500/1,000, 100 ante
Chris Torres
Chris Torres

Chris Torres is running hot here on Day 1a and just busted a player in a multiple-raised pot that went three ways to a {j-}{3-}{3-} flop. The first player bet 20,000 and Torres moved all in, covering everyone. The player on the button folded, and the bettor called off his last 10,000 or so with {q-Clubs}{q-Spades}. Torres had it crushed with {k-}{k-} and the board ran out clean for him. He appears to be the chip leader.

Ace Doesn't Crack Gaubert's Kings

Level 7 : 400/800, 100 ante

A player in the big blind check-called 6,500 from Jeremy Gaubert with the board reading {5-Diamonds}{j-Spades}{10-Diamonds}{5-Hearts} on fourth street. Gaubert saw his opponent toss 5,000 in on the {a-Hearts} river. Gaubert splashed in a call, and his opponent showed {k-}{j-}. Gaubert had it beat with {k-Diamonds}{k-Hearts}.

Dudek Eliminated

Level 6 : 300/600, 75 ante

We found Gene Dudek shoving all in for 3,125 and getting called by Mary Ellen Roy, who had come into the pot under the gun, and a third player. The two active players checked through the {2-Clubs}{6-Diamonds}{8-Hearts}{q-Diamonds}{6-Clubs} board and Dudek held his cards over to muck.

"Jack-high," he said.

"King-high," Roy announced, tabling {k-Spades}{j-Clubs}.

The third player showed {k-}{9-} for worse king-high and Dudek mucked {j-Spades}{9-Diamonds}.
